Hardware Installation and Setup
The RMX 1500/RMX 2000 unit should be mounted in a 19”rack in a well ventilated area. The RMX 4000 unit can be mounted in a 19” or 23”rack in a well ventilated area. Installing the RMX 1500
For detailed instructions, precautions and requirements for installing the RMX 1500 refer to the Polycom RMX 1500 Hardware Guide.
The following procedures have to be performed to install the RMX 1500 in your site:
•Installing the RMX in a rack or as a standalone
•Connecting the RMX 1500 to the power source
•Connecting the network (LAN, IP and ISDN) cables to the RMX.
Mounting the RMX 1500 in a Rack
There are two methods for installing the RMX in a 19” rack:
•Using the chassis runners on the RMX 1500
—Install the chassis runners provided by Polycom in the rack using the screws supplied by the rack manufacturer; two screws per chassis runner.
